Product Overview

The AG5863DA1 Digital RS485 4-20mA Residual Chlorine Sensor utilizes advanced membrane method technology for precise measurement of free chlorine levels in water systems. This industrial-grade sensor is designed for applications requiring accurate monitoring of residual chlorine to ensure effective disinfection while maintaining environmental compliance.

Key Features
  • Membrane method technology accelerates response time and ensures stable signal output
  • POM and 316 stainless steel construction withstands temperatures from 0 to 45°C
  • Pure copper leads provide accurate and stable signal transmission for remote applications
  • Multiple output options: 4-20mA, RS485, and 0~±2V signals
  • Built-in temperature compensation for reliable performance across varying conditions
Technical Specifications
Parameter Specification
Measurement Variable Free Chlorine (pH-dependent)
pH Range 6.0-8.0
Operating Temperature 0-45°C
Maximum Pressure 1.0 bar
Flow Rate 15-30 L/h (in flow cell)
Response Time Initial polarization: ~1 hour; T90: 30 seconds
Power Supply 9-36 VDC
Maintenance Cycle Membrane cap: 1 year; Electrolyte: 3-6 months
Application Industries

Tap water systems, drinking water facilities, mineral water production, service water monitoring, and process water treatment applications.
